i was lucky/unlucky enough to watch the big boy through his entire laker career. in his prime, he could make you absolutely crazy for 60 games, then turn it on for the last 24 and you'd think "what a great player." Then he'd show up for training camp the next year 2 weeks late and 40 pounds overweight. he got a lot of love from the local sporting press because he was such a good quote and so easy-going to be around (at least, as opposed to kobe).
as for walton ... maybe the top 5 college centers ever? not the pros. hard to lionize someone who only had 3 seasons of more than 60 games. he's a great "could have been". shame too, a real character.
